这会将框定位在顶部下方一点HelloWorld这会将框定位在顶部附近,看起来height和top属性都不是在职的。盒子的高度不是50%,盒子不是低于顶部的50%。HelloWorld我在这方面几乎是个初学者,但如果left和width与百分比一起工作似乎不应该是top和height? 最佳答案 如果它的父级没有固定高度,你的盒子不能有一个高度,即它的父级的百分比,因为那样盒子就不知道它需要多高(通常这样的父元素是body或其他一些包装元素)。作为直接结果,带有百分比的top也不会产生任何影响。
我有以下页面:[LINK]页面被设计为水平滚动,因此一系列div(黑色边框的)出现在一行中。现在,我将较小的div(红色的)设置为永远不会超出父div,但与此同时,在滚动页面时,我希望它们在父div内移动,就像它们是固定的一样-定位。我会用图表来解释。我希望我的div表现得像这样:[LINK]有人可以帮忙吗?感谢您的宝贵时间! 最佳答案 更新创建了一些最小的/实验性的jQuery插件:https://gist.github.com/3177804你应该能够像这样使用它:http://jsfiddle.net/7q3Zu/2/下载并包
我有以下页面:[LINK]页面被设计为水平滚动,因此一系列div(黑色边框的)出现在一行中。现在,我将较小的div(红色的)设置为永远不会超出父div,但与此同时,在滚动页面时,我希望它们在父div内移动,就像它们是固定的一样-定位。我会用图表来解释。我希望我的div表现得像这样:[LINK]有人可以帮忙吗?感谢您的宝贵时间! 最佳答案 更新创建了一些最小的/实验性的jQuery插件:https://gist.github.com/3177804你应该能够像这样使用它:http://jsfiddle.net/7q3Zu/2/下载并包
好的,这是一个例子:http://jsfiddle.net/jGLvk/405/如果将鼠标悬停在9012菜单上,您将切下绝对的下拉子菜单。从其任何父项中删除position:absolute或overflow:hidden:您将拥有正常工作的下拉菜单。“Overflow-y:visible”只会生成一个滚动条而不是显示菜单。请帮帮我!在如此棘手的祖先中,我需要一个常规的superfish下拉菜单。谢谢! 最佳答案 来,看看。我不确定overflow:hidden的用途是什么,但它是否适用于divul而不是div?如果是这样,那就去做
好的,这是一个例子:http://jsfiddle.net/jGLvk/405/如果将鼠标悬停在9012菜单上,您将切下绝对的下拉子菜单。从其任何父项中删除position:absolute或overflow:hidden:您将拥有正常工作的下拉菜单。“Overflow-y:visible”只会生成一个滚动条而不是显示菜单。请帮帮我!在如此棘手的祖先中,我需要一个常规的superfish下拉菜单。谢谢! 最佳答案 来,看看。我不确定overflow:hidden的用途是什么,但它是否适用于divul而不是div?如果是这样,那就去做
我是一个meteor.jsnuub,但我确实花了很多时间来弄清楚这个问题。我正在尝试根据传递到getCurrentPosition的HTML5地理定位API回调来响应式更新我的UI。但是,UI未使用我当前的代码进行更新。您能提供建议和/或解决方案吗?以下是详细信息:基础知识:meteor服务器正在运行,通过集合成功地向/从mongo提供其他数据我有一个主页(main.html):GeolocationGeolocation{{>location}}引用模板(location.js):Lat:{{lat}}Lon:{{lon}}有这个关联的助手(location.js):_lat={cu
我是一个meteor.jsnuub,但我确实花了很多时间来弄清楚这个问题。我正在尝试根据传递到getCurrentPosition的HTML5地理定位API回调来响应式更新我的UI。但是,UI未使用我当前的代码进行更新。您能提供建议和/或解决方案吗?以下是详细信息:基础知识:meteor服务器正在运行,通过集合成功地向/从mongo提供其他数据我有一个主页(main.html):GeolocationGeolocation{{>location}}引用模板(location.js):Lat:{{lat}}Lon:{{lon}}有这个关联的助手(location.js):_lat={cu
我有一个元素,我正在使用位置粘性设置粘性:#header{position:sticky;width:100vw;top:0;}这很好用,但我意识到如果我使用:body{overflow-x:hidden;}这打破了粘性,我需要将bodyoverflow-x设置为hidden,我该如何解决这个问题,只有CSS解决方案,没有JS解决方案? 最佳答案 将overflow-x属性设置为值clip帮助我实现位置粘性并防止滚动。这里有更多的解释thisarticle 关于html-正文{溢出-x:
我有一个元素,我正在使用位置粘性设置粘性:#header{position:sticky;width:100vw;top:0;}这很好用,但我意识到如果我使用:body{overflow-x:hidden;}这打破了粘性,我需要将bodyoverflow-x设置为hidden,我该如何解决这个问题,只有CSS解决方案,没有JS解决方案? 最佳答案 将overflow-x属性设置为值clip帮助我实现位置粘性并防止滚动。这里有更多的解释thisarticle 关于html-正文{溢出-x:
我看到固定位置元素在相对定位的父元素中的行为方式存在差异。根据我在网上找到的文档,FireFox和Chrome应该将元素修复到视口(viewport)而不是父元素。但是,我发现如果我没有在固定元素上指定左/右值,它的行为表现为静态和固定之间的某种混合,从某种意义上说,它垂直固定到视口(viewport),但移动时好像它是父元素中的静态元素。我找不到任何关于这些条件的官方/受尊重的文件。他们基本上都是这样说的:FixedPositioningDonotleavespacefortheelement.Instead,positionitataspecifiedpositionrelativ